I am looking at changing my cardio routine and want to add Tae Kwon Do. I went to a couple of Tae Kwon Do classes years ago and liked it, and at 300 pounds it really gave me a work out. Anyone post op taken up Tae Kwon Do and did you feel you got a good enough work out? I am just worried that it won't be enough since I do a much more intense workout now.

I think you will get what you put into it.  Some of the cardio kickboxing classes, or regular boxing classes are a great cardio workout.  The regular martial arts classes don't tend to be focused as much on fitness as they are techniques.  You might be able to do an occasional private lesson with the instructor and tell them what you are looking for.

I'm not sure what your class is like, but we always had a good 30 minutes of warmup exercises before class.  Situps, pushups, ab work, jumping jacks etc.  Then we would get into the technique portion of class.

Give it a try see if you can sign up for just a month and see if you are getting the kind of workout you want.  You might want to use it as an additional exercise, not as something to replace what you are already doing.
